Marathon P'tit Train du Nord, from Val-David to St. Jerome, Quebec, on about the most perfect day ever for running, 35-47, light winds quartering from behind and the left, net downhill course, and just gorgeous, catching the most spectacular fall colors I have seen in some years. We just loved our trip here, staying in a beautiful large apartment literally overlooking the starting line, so we didn't even head out the door until 9 minutes until the start, which was in 5 minute waves, which we could here them announce. About as well run a race as I have seen. Truly exceptional. As for my run, it was a tough day at the office, where I sort of inexplicably couldn't produce the speed of my training. Perhaps I was overtrained, but I am not sure -- not a horrible day by any means, running a minute and a half negative splits (always good in a marathon), but just at a slower pace than I thought I was ready for. Still, a BQ with 8:35 to spare, so next September I should be good for signing up to run as a 69 year old. And then after that I will be able to try to BQ (never, ever guaranteed in this life....) as a 70 year old.
